SD Jamaat Website

Current tooling:

  • GatsbyJS & React
  • Ant Design UI and Bootstrap
  • Firebase Cloudstore as DB
  • Firebase Cloud Functions

Local Development

Step 1: Clone the repository with Git

git clone https://github.com/sdjamaat/website.git sdjwebsite
cd sdjwebsite

Step 2: Download npm modules (NodeJS and Yarninstallation required).

yarn install

Warning: DO NOT use npm to do this - it will screw up the entire project. If you do accidently install using npm instead of yarn, delete your node_modules folder and also delete your package-lock.json file. Then follow the step listed above again.

Step 3: Run locally on live server

npm run dev
# then navigate to localhost:8000

Install new npm modules

Always use yarn to install new npm modules - otherwise, follow the warning message below if you accidently install with npm.

yarn add [some npm module]

Working with Firebase Functions

In this repository, there is a folder called functions which contains code related to Firebase cloud functions.

Step 1: Install the firebase-tools npm package globally

npm install -g firebase-tools

Step 2: Go into the functions directory. You will need to install dependencies here as well, however with npm this time instead of yarn

cd functions
npm install

To deploy new functions:

Helpful link: https://firebase.googleblog.com/2016/07/deploy-to-multiple-environments-with.html

Step 1: You need to first be log into the webmaster@sandiegojamaat.net Google account. You only need to do this once (unless you're switching between other Firebase accounts)

# this will open up a browser window where you'll need to login
firebase login

Step 2: Use this shell command to deploy the functions:

firebase deploy --only functions
